> Congratulations! Looks like it was a power supply problem.
>
> USB power supplies fail. I had one that would show +5V under no load, but 
> it would sag to near nothing with just a modest load.

>>>>>>>>> Just a quick question. Do you have a monitor (like the Pi 7 in 
>>>>>>>>> touch screen) attached that is running off the same power supply as 
>>>>>>>>> the Pi? 
>>>>>>>>> I had a setup like that which used a splitter to power both the 
>>>>>>>>> monitor and 
>>>>>>>>> Pi from one power pack. My setup kept complaining of undervolting 
>>>>>>>>> until I 
>>>>>>>>> removed the splitter and plugged the monitor and pi each into their 
>>>>>>>>> own 
>>>>>>>>> power supply.
